A sign hanging off the back of one of the tents at Barbecue Fest let's everyone know that their tent is a private party. (Typically, the mayor's tent is open to the public.)
In other news:
- All good things must come to an end, I suppose. I'm sad to report that Lux boutique in Cooper Young will be closing sometime in June. The closure is as a result of the economy and the owner feeling like it's time to move on. Currently, all of their clothing and accessories are 30% off.
- For the entire month of May, Fuel Cafe on Madison is selling brownies to raise money for the Memphis Gay and Lesbian Community Center. This is one of those times when it's totally fine to say yes to dessert.
